AnimSync.js
一个异步库,具有简单的类似于同步的语法。
该库专注于提供动画和过渡的高级方法。在语法上将代码拆分为一些小巧的外观,并且易于调试。
时间和动画
过渡
_.transition是一种用于创建基本的从到转换的方法。它接受四个基本参数。第一个参数是持续时间(以ms ,而第二个参数指定应在多长时间后解析函数,这将允许时间上重叠的过渡。其他参数是计时功能和回调。
// Play a second long transition, and resolve after 500ms
aw
movy.js是基于three.js和gsap的易于使用的动画引擎。
入门
确保在计算机上安装了 。
您可以通过以下方式简单地安装movy.js :
npm i -g movy
要运行movy.js ,请在终端中输入以下命令:
movy
它将在examples文件夹中显示示例动画的列表。
要创建自己的动画,可以启动一个新的javascr ipt文件。 以下是一个简单的hello-world示例:
import * as mo from "movy" ;
const t = mo